This document refers to a feature that was removed after Graph API v3.2.
Graph API Version

/{event-id}/attending

The people who are attending an event.

Permissions

  • Any access token can be used to retrieve events with privacy set to OPEN.
  • A user access token can be used to retrieve any events that are visible to that person.
  • An app or page token can be used to retrieve any events that were created by that app or page.
  • Events may not be visible due to privacy, age restrictions, or geographic restrictions.

Fields

A list of User objects and the following additional field:

NameDescriptionType

rsvp_status

What the status of each users RSVP to the event is.

string

Permissions

  • A user access token with rsvp_event permission is required.

Fields

No fields are required to RSVP to an event, the session user identifies who will be RSVPed.

Response

If successful:

{
  "success": true
}

Otherwise a relevant error message will be returned.

Deleting

You cannot delete RSVP status, but it can be changed by publishing against a different RSVP status edge.
